Q: Is 1,460,890 a Prime Number?
A: No, 1,460,890 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 1460890 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 139 278 695 1,051 1,390 2,102 5,255 10,510 146,089 292,178 730,445 and 1,460,890, with no remainder.
Since 1,460,890 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,460,890, it is not a prime number.
